In Memory of Louis Dellwig

Louis Dellwig

February 13, 1922 – April 30, 2012

Louis enjoying a feast of delicious food

By observation, Louis was the quiet one at the dinner table.  It appeared that he just simply enjoyed eating. In actuality, Louis had a big sweet tooth. In fact, he would eat his meal just so he could savor dessert. The day he admitted this to me he grinned from ear-to-ear, resembling a sneaky little boy who luckily never got caught with his hand in the cookie jar. From then on, when I helped myself to a freshly baked, hot-out-of-the-oven cookie, I snagged one for Louis too, so we could be partners in cookie crime.
